The Oil & Gas Journal, first published in 1902, is the world's most widely read petroleum industry publication. OGJ delivers international oil and gas industry news; analysis of issues and events; practical technology for design, operation, and maintenance of oil and gas operations; and important statistics on energy markets and industry activity.

OGJ is edited to meet the needs of engineers, geoscientists, managers, and executives throughout the oil and gas industry. It is part of Endeavor Business Media, Nashville, Tenn., which also publishes Offshore Magazine.

Endeavor Business Media’s Petroleum Group also produces targeted e-Newsletters; hosts global conferences and exhibitions, seminars, and forums; and publishes directories, technical books, print and electronic databases, surveys, and maps.

Darling Ingredients Inc. Announces Dual Listing on NYSE Texas

Darling Ingredients Inc. (NYSE: DAR), the world’s leading company in turning food waste into sustainable products and producer of renewable energy, today announced a dual listing of its common stock on NYSE Texas, the new, fully electronic equities exchange based in Dallas, Texas.

“Joining NYSE Texas as a founding member reflects our forward-looking approach to the evolving capital markets,” said Randall C. Stuewe, Chairman and Chief Executive Officer of Darling Ingredients. “This dual listing aligns with our commitment to innovation and growth within the vibrant Texas economy. By expanding our presence through listing on NYSE Texas, we’re positioning the company to access emerging opportunities, attract a broader investor base and support long-term value creation in a rapidly transforming financial environment.”

“Since Darling Ingredients’ start as a Chicago rendering company more than 140 years ago, it has continued to grow and create value in the animal agriculture and food industries,” said Chris Taylor, Chief Development Officer, NYSE Group. “We are proud that Darling Ingredients, a key leader in sustainability, is now a Founding Member of NYSE Texas.”

Darling Ingredients will retain its primary listing on the New York Stock Exchange and will also trade under the “DAR” ticker symbol on NYSE Texas.

About Darling Ingredients

A pioneer in circularity, Darling Ingredients Inc. (NYSE: DAR) takes material from the animal agriculture and food industries, and transforms them into valuable ingredients that nourish people, feed animals and crops, and fuel the world with renewable energy. The company operates over 260 facilities in more than 15 countries and processes about 15% of the world’s animal agricultural by-products, produces about 30% of the world’s collagen (both gelatin and hydrolyzed collagen), and is one of the largest producers of renewable energy.
